Designation:A55016Standard Specification forFerrocolumbium(Ferroniobium)1This standard is issued under the fixed designation A550;the number immediately following the designation indicates the year oforiginal adoption or,in the case of revision,the year of last revision.A number in parentheses indicates the year of last reapproval.Asuperscript epsilon()indicates an editorial change since the last revision or reapproval.1.Scope*1.1 This specification covers three grades of Ferrocolum-bium(ferroniobium),designated Low-Alloy Steel Grade,Al-loy and Stainless Steel Grade,and High-Purity Grade.1.2 The values stated in inch-pound units are to be regardedas standard.The values given in parentheses are mathematicalconversions to SI units that are provided for information onlyand are not considered standard.2.Referenced Documents2.1 ASTM Standards:2A1025 Specification for Ferroalloys and Other AlloyingMaterials,General RequirementsE11 Specification for Woven Wire Test Sieve Cloth and TestSieves3.General Conditions for Delivery3.1 Materials furnished to this specification shall conform tothe requirements of Specification A1025,including any supple-mentary requirements that are indicated in the purchase order.Failure to comply with the general requirements of Specifica-tion A1025 constitutes nonconformance with this specification.In case of conflict between the requirements of this specifica-tion and Specification A1025,this specification shall prevail.4.Chemical Composition4.1 The material shall conform to the requirements as tochemical composition specified in Tables 1 and 2.The manu-facturer shall furnish an analysis of each shipment showing thepercentage of each element specified in Table 1.4.2 For elements specified in Table 2 an analysis of each lotis not required.Upon request of the purchaser,the manufac-turer shall supply the results of an analysis for the elementsspecified in Table 2 on a cumulative basis over a periodmutually agreed upon by the manufacturer and the purchaser.5.Sizing5.1 Ferrocolumbium(ferroniobium)is available in sizes andto tolerances shown in Table 3.6.Keywords6.1 columbium(niobium);ferrocolumbium(ferroniobium);tantalum1This specification is under the jurisdiction of ASTM Committee A01 on Steel,Stainless Steel and Related Alloys and is the direct responsibility of SubcommitteeA01.18 on Castings.Current edition approved May 1,2016.Published May 2016.Originallyapproved in 1965.Last previous edition approved in 2015 as A550 06(2015).DOI:10.1520/A0550-16.2For referenced ASTM standards,visit the ASTM website,www.astm.org,orcontact ASTM Customer Service at serviceastm.org.For Annual Book of ASTMStandards volume information,refer to the standards Document Summary page onthe ASTM website.*A Summary of Changes section appears at the end of this standardCopyright ASTM International,100 Barr Harbor Drive,PO Box C700,West Conshohocken,PA 19428-2959.United
